Over the past decade, the landscape of mobile gaming has undergone a seismic shift. Once dominated by simple puzzle and casual titles, modern smartphones now host complex, graphically rich, and highly strategic experiences. Among these innovations, real-time strategy (RTS) games have begun to carve out a significant niche, leveraging advancements in hardware, connectivity, and user interface design to deliver console-quality experiences on handheld devices.
Traditional RTS titles such as Starcraft or Command & Conquer have long been staples of PC and console gaming, celebrated for their depth, strategic complexity, and competitive ecosystems. Transitioning these experiences onto mobile required overcoming formidable challenges: limited screen real estate, touch-based controls, and the necessity for intuitive interfaces capable of handling complex commands swiftly.
Recent industry insights indicate that mobile RTS games have become increasingly popular, with market data revealing a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 15% over the last four years. Titles like Clash of Clans and Last Shelter: Survival have demonstrated that players are eager for sophisticated strategic gameplay on their smartphones, provided the experience is optimised for mobile environments.
